The title says it all. I thought this had been solved by the update (like a week after release date or something). But alas it is back. Anybody else experiencing this? I tried all variants of brightness settings to no avail. Every time I want to play a video from the gallery app, I navigate to it, the representative frame is nice and bright, and just prior to playback, the entire screen darkens significantly. Thoughts?

Posted via Android Central App
 
I noticed mine is the opposite, mine goes to full brightness when I play a video from the gallery.

There is a setting to adjust it. As soon as you start a video hit the screen and than hit the menu button on the phone when it shows up. From there you can click on settings and set the brightness for all videos. Once you set it than it should stay that way.
 
You can also drag a finger up or down on the left side of the screen during playback. That will increase and decrease video brightness.
